In a few places we compare signed and unsigned integers. In majority of cases it's because the iteration variable is declared as ssize_t but then in the for() loop it's compared against an unsigned int. But there is one case where the opposite happens (libvirt_virDomainSendKey()), or where an UINT_MAX (which is inherently unsigned) is compared against signed long. Also, use this opportunity to decrease scope of 'j' variable inside of libvirt_virDomainInterfaceAddresses(). Signed-off-by: Michal Privoznik <mprivozn@redhat.com>
